Riyadh, Saudi Arabia – The $20 million Saudi cup (G1), scheduled for Saturday at King Abdulaziz Racecourse, is generating notable buzz. Handicappers largely agree on a favorite: Forever Young. This Japanese star boasts impressive credentials, despite drawing the outside No. 14 post. His main challenger, Romantic Warrior, a ten-time Group 1 winner with over $22 million in earnings, faces the unique challenge of competing on a dirt track for the first time.
Of seven handicappers surveyed, five selected Forever Young as the winner.One chose Romantic Warrior, and another opted for the longshot, Walk of Stars. Forever Young, trained by yoshito Yahagi, concluded his 3-year-old season with a commanding 1 ¾-length victory over Wilson Tesoro in the Tokyo Daishoten (G1) on Dec. 29. Wilson Tesoro, Ramjet, and Ushba Tesoro, all participants in that race, will again challenge Forever Young in the Saudi Cup.
The field also includes several Saudi-owned longshots,the European representative Facteur Cheval,and the U.S. runner Rattle N Roll. Forever Young, a son of Real Steel, boasts a remarkable seven wins in nine career starts. His only defeats came in the U.S., where he finished third in both the Kentucky Derby (G1) and the Breeders’ Cup Classic (G1). “the gifted international star returns to the scene of his victory last year in the Saudi Derby,”
noted The Professor. “His dirt experience gives him an edge over the classy Romantic Warrior.”
While Romantic Warrior’s ten Group 1 victories substantially outweigh Forever Young’s single Group 1 win, the turf-to-dirt transition presents a considerable hurdle. “A thrilling closing run to edge Book’em Danno in the Saudi Derby (on dirt) a year ago at this track gives me confidence he can do it again in the Saudi Cup,”
stated Captain Morgan. Romantic Warrior, a veteran of races in Australia, Dubai, and Hong Kong, will start from post No. 3 with his regular rider,James McDonald. MadMax expressed confidence, stating, “at 5-2 morning-line odds, he will get out early and run to victory.”
For those seeking a longshot, Walk of Stars, a 6-year-old gelding trained by Bhupat Seemar, presents an intriguing option. Seemar also trains Laurel River, a horse initially considered a Saudi Cup favorite but now sidelined. HorseCents noted, “Connections know how to light up the tote board on the international stage. Trainer’s barn star (Laurel River) skips the race so this one can run.”
Racing4$ summarized the sentiment, adding, “Experience in dirt races and a win over this track give Forever Young the edge.”
Handicapper Predictions
The handicappers’ top three picks offer a diverse range of predictions:
- Captain Morgan: 1. Forever Young, 2. Ushba Tesoro, 3.Walk of Stars
- Trackenstein: 1. Forever young, 2.Romantic Warrior, 3. Rattle N Roll
- The Professor: 1. Forever Young, 2. Romantic Warrior, 3.Rattle N Roll
- MadMax: 1. Romantic Warrior, 2. Forever Young, 3. Rattle N Roll
- Racing4$: 1. Forever Young, 2. Ushba Tesoro, 3. Rattle N Roll
- HorseCents: 1. Walk of Stars, 2. Rattle N Roll, 3. Romantic Warrior
- Mr. Tout: 1. Forever Young,2. Facteur Cheval, 3. Romantic Warrior
